如何在 Ionic Pro 中设置正确版本的播放服务
How set the correct version of play-services in Ionic Pro
在项目替换中平台/android/projet.properties以下参数
com.google.android.gms:play-services-maps:+
cordova.system.library.3=com.google.android.gms:play-services-location:+
如何替换项目或配置中的相同内容,然后将其充电到 ionic pro 并构建它?
我使用了下一个插件:cordova-android-play-services-gradle-release
- ionic cordova 插件添加 cordova-android-play-services-gradle-release
- ionic cordova 平台删除 android
- ionic cordova 平台添加 android@6.4.0
这解决了我的问题。
我们有一些稍微不同的问题,使用 cordova-android-play-services-gradle-release 没有解决。
我们使用 cordova-plugin-background-geolocation 添加
com.google.android.gms:play-services-location:11+
这与 phonegap-plugin-push 冲突。 (我认为与 OP 的区别在于最后指定的 -location)
找不到播放服务位置的 gradle,因此唯一的修复方法是重新安装指定 --GOOGLE_PLAY_SERVICES_VERSION 的插件,例如...
cordova plugin add cordova-plugin-mauron85-background-geolocation --variable GOOGLE_PLAY_SERVICES_VERSION=11.6.2
我对 cordova 开发相当陌生,但我的印象是大多数(所有?)插件都允许您指定此变量,您应该理所当然地使用它来解决这些冲突。
在项目替换中平台/android/projet.properties以下参数
com.google.android.gms:play-services-maps:+
cordova.system.library.3=com.google.android.gms:play-services-location:+
如何替换项目或配置中的相同内容,然后将其充电到 ionic pro 并构建它?
我使用了下一个插件:cordova-android-play-services-gradle-release
- ionic cordova 插件添加 cordova-android-play-services-gradle-release
- ionic cordova 平台删除 android
- ionic cordova 平台添加 android@6.4.0
这解决了我的问题。
我们有一些稍微不同的问题,使用 cordova-android-play-services-gradle-release 没有解决。
我们使用 cordova-plugin-background-geolocation 添加
com.google.android.gms:play-services-location:11+
这与 phonegap-plugin-push 冲突。 (我认为与 OP 的区别在于最后指定的 -location)
找不到播放服务位置的 gradle,因此唯一的修复方法是重新安装指定 --GOOGLE_PLAY_SERVICES_VERSION 的插件,例如...
cordova plugin add cordova-plugin-mauron85-background-geolocation --variable GOOGLE_PLAY_SERVICES_VERSION=11.6.2
我对 cordova 开发相当陌生,但我的印象是大多数(所有?)插件都允许您指定此变量,您应该理所当然地使用它来解决这些冲突。